Output 99762161d119442868fbf268cf80b18a90cff4c31ff702a6796ae78ffa4be6dd:1

value
20360358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db267e6c4572c3ad099293e2a1fd9270d31cce5c OP_EQUAL
address
3Mfn29rZHpR3RUdqQJsb4qD8Kiq7yYxjxi
transaction
99762161d119442868fbf268cf80b18a90cff4c31ff702a6796ae78ffa4be6dd
spent
true